Embracing Data Analytics and AI in Health Policy Research

Data anal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) are transforming health policy research. These technologies allow researchers to process vast amounts of data quickly and accurately, identifying trends and patterns that might otherwise go unnoticed. For instance, AI can be used to predict disease outbreaks or assess the impact of health interventions on different demographics. Undergraduate certificate programs are increasingly integrating courses on data analytics and AI, ensuring that students are well-versed in these critical skills.

Imagine a scenario where a student uses AI to analyze healthcare utilization data. By identifying disparities in access to healthcare services, the student can propose policy changes that address these inequalities. This hands-on experience not only enhances their research skills but also provides a tangible impact on public health initiatives.

Interdisciplinary Collaboration: Bridging Gaps for Better Outcomes

Health policy research is inherently interdisciplinary, drawing from fields such as economics, sociology, and public health. This multidisciplinary approach is vital for addressing complex health issues. Undergraduate certificates in health policy research are fostering collaboration across different disciplines, encouraging students to work with experts from various backgrounds.

For example, a student studying health policy research might collaborate with an economist to analyze the cost-effectiveness of a public health campaign. This interdisciplinary collaboration can lead to more robust and comprehensive policy recommendations. Future developments in this area include more integrated curriculum designs that emphasize teamwork and cross-sector collaboration, preparing students to work in diverse healthcare environments.

Innovations in Healthcare Delivery and Policy Implementation

Innovations in healthcare delivery are also influencing health policy research. Telemedicine, for instance, has become a critical component of healthcare, especially in remote areas. Policies that facilitate telemedicine can improve access to healthcare services, but they also come with challenges such as ensuring data privacy and maintaining quality of care. Undergraduate programs are adapting to these changes by incorporating courses on telehealth and digital health policy.

Another innovative area is the use of participatory research methods, which involve community members in the research process. This approach ensures that policies are not only evidence-based but also community-centered, addressing the specific needs and concerns of the population. Future developments may see more emphasis on participatory research, empowering communities to have a say in the policies that affect them.

Preparing for the Future: Skills and Ethics in Health Policy Research

As the field of health policy research continues to evolve, so do the skills and ethical considerations required. Future policies will need to address emerging health challenges such as climate change and the aging population. Undergraduate certificates are equipping students with the skills needed to tackle these issues, including advanced research methods and ethical decision-making frameworks.

Ethical considerations are particularly crucial in health policy research. Students must understand the ethical implications of their work, ensuring that policies are fair, equitable, and respectful of individual rights. Future developments in this area may include more comprehensive ethics training, preparing students to navigate the moral complexities of health policy research.
